Forging Resilience in Silver
Moving from a flat blueprint to a three-dimensional object demands force and fire. The initial sheet of silver is stubborn and resists bending. To shape it into the intended wave, the metal must first undergo the process of annealing.
We apply a torch until the silver reaches 650 degrees Celsius, emitting a dull red glow. This heat alters the crystalline structure of the alloy, forcing the molecules to relax. It is closer to loosening a clenched hand than melting a form away: the structure remains, but its resistance drops enough for the next gesture.
This leaves the metal soft and deeply malleable once it cools. Once shaped, the yielding metal must be reinforced. Striking the silver with a chasing hammer causes it to undergo work-hardening. Each deliberate blow compacts the molecules again, locking the curved form into place and restoring the integrity of the material. The hammer does not erase the softness that came before it. It gives that temporary softness a fixed direction.
- Annealing
- Heat applied to 650°C causes the silver’s crystalline structure to loosen. Molecular bonds relax, reducing internal stress and making the metal receptive to shaping. The form becomes temporarily soft — not weak, but open to direction.
- Work-hardening
- Repeated hammer strikes compress the molecular structure in the opposite direction, locking the newly shaped form and rebuilding density. The metal that was softened by heat is now harder at the curve than it was as a flat sheet.

A Tactile Anchor for the Mind
A pendant exists in a space that is intensely personal, resting against the chest. Its value is measured by how it interacts with your daily physical reality. The surface treatment of the metal is applied with this specific interaction in mind.
The finishing process involves three distinct actions:
- Brushing liver of sulfur into the recesses for a dense, oxidized black finish.
- Filing the raised ridges to define the crests of the curve.
- Rubbing the high points with ascending grits of sandpaper until the silver gleams.
The contrast between the matte recesses and hand-polished ridges creates a varied topography. This is a functional design meant to serve as a tactile anchor. The alternating texture invites physical interaction throughout the day.

Sterling silver can naturally tarnish over time due to exposure to air and moisture. Storing your pendant in an airtight pouch when not worn will help slow this natural process.
For general cleaning, use a soft cloth with mild soap and water, avoiding abrasive materials. For oxidized pieces, gently wipe only the polished areas to maintain the intended textural contrast.
